Adult Care Trainer
Ready to Share Your Expertise and Inspire Others?
Salary: From £29,000 + tax-free bonus | Location: Hybrid (covering the Kent area) | Role: Adult Care Trainer
Ready for a fresh challenge that builds on your experience as a Deputy Manager, Team Leader or Senior Carer? Join The Opportunity Provider , an award-winning training provider, as an Adult Care Trainer. Share your expertise while enjoying regular Monday-to-Friday hours, with the flexibility of working from home and visiting learners in their care homes.
What You'll Be Doing:
Supporting and guiding apprentices in care homes and online, helping them build their skills and grow their confidence. Tailoring learning plans to suit each apprentice’s needs and providing the tools they need to succeed. Showing how functional skills like maths and English fit into their day-to-day roles. Building relationships with employers and keeping them updated on their apprentices’ progress. Managing administrative tasks efficiently using Google Suite and other platforms.

Your typical week will include at least 3 days of travel to care homes within your area, with the rest of your time spent working from home.
What You'll Need to Bring:
Experience as a Deputy Manager, Team Leader or Senior Carer (or similar). Level 3 qualification in Adult Care (or similar). Confidence with technology and strong organisational skills. Level 2 (GCSE) qualification in English and maths (or a willingness to work towards it). A full driving licence and access to your own vehicle for travel within your area.
Why Work With Us?
We invest in your growth so you can continue to inspire and support others. That’s why we provide access to qualifications and development opportunities to help you grow in your role, including an apprenticeship programme to become a trainer.
We also offer:
A starting salary from £29,000 plus tax-free bonuses when company targets are met. 25 days’ holiday (plus bank holidays) and an extra day for your birthday. The option to buy or sell up to five additional days’ leave. Healthcare cash plan, dental plan, hospital treatment plan, employee assistance programmes, and 24/7 GP access. Enhanced sick pay and life insurance. Reimbursement for mileage and travel expenses
